Draymond Green discusses KAT's impact in Knicks' NBA Finals run

Draymond Green praised Karl-Anthony Towns for his performance during the Knicks' 2026 NBA Finals run. Green noted Towns' improved toughness and intensity, which he believes is key to New York's success. Towns has averaged 19.5 points, 12.5 rebounds, and four assists in the first two games against the Spurs. His defensive performance against Victor Wembanyama, who shot just 28.6% in Game 1, has sparked significant discussion. Game 3 is scheduled for Monday evening, where Towns' defensive matchup will again be highlighted.
